Ramez Naam Discusses Brain-Computer Interfaces At Google

SingularityHub Staff
Jan 29, 2013

Share

Nexus author and Singularity Hub contributor Ramez Naam discusses the technology that will allow brain-computer interfacing at Authors@Google.
